Why the 48x40 pallet won

We push about 620 pallets a week on my floor — anyone know the real origin of 48x40 as the US default: railcar dimensions, grocery standards, or forklift tine spacing? I care because forcing that spec across lines cut our trailer load-planning by 12 minutes and reduced snags at the docks, and I want the accurate backstory.

‌⁠‍⁠​‍​‍‌⁠‌​​‍​‍​⁠‍‍​‍​‍‌‍‌⁠‌‍⁠‌‌‍‍‍​⁠‌​​‍​‍​‍⁠​​‍​‍‌‍‍⁠​‍​‍​⁠‍‍​‍​‍‌‍⁠‍‌‍‌‌‌⁠‌⁠‌‌⁠⁠‌⁠‌​‌‍⁠⁠‌⁠​​‌‍‍‌‌‍​⁠​‍​‍​‍⁠​​‍​‍‌‍‍‌‌‍‌​​‍​‍​⁠‍‍​‍​‍‌‍⁠‍‌‍‌‌‌⁠‌⁠​‍​‍​‍⁠​​‍​‍‌‍‌​​‍​‍​⁠‍‍​‍​‍​⁠​‍​⁠​​​⁠​‍​⁠‌‍​⁠​​​⁠​‌​⁠​‍​⁠‌⁠​‍​‍​‍⁠​​‍​‍‌‍‍​​‍​‍​⁠‍‍​‍​‍​⁠​​‌‍⁠‌‌‍‍⁠‌‌​‍‌‍⁠⁠‌​​⁠‌​‌‍​‍⁠‌‌​⁠​‌⁠‌‍‌⁠‌​‌‌​‍‌​‌​‌‌‍‌​⁠‍‌​⁠​‍​‍​‍‌⁠⁠‌​

It’s mostly a GMA thing from the ’60s — 48×40 to fit two across in 8‑ft boxcars/trailers and standardize grocery DCs; forks followed, not led (shoes after the feet). Source: “GMA pallet” and MH1, with CHEP later cementing it; https://en.wikipedia.org/wiki/GMA_pallet — if you’re enforcing 48×40, are you loading 40‑across to cube out, or do you weight out first?
